Why “Free” Never Means Free

Right from the get‑go, the phrase “888 ladies casino 50 free spins no deposit instant” sounds like a promise of easy cash. It isn’t. It’s a carefully crafted bait hook, a glittering lure that masks the cold arithmetic of risk and house edge.

Imagine you’re at a dull pub, and the bartender slides you a complimentary shot of whisky. You’re thinking, “Cheers, mate!” but the next thing you know, you’re coughing up a bill for the round you never ordered. That’s the exact feeling when a sponsor touts “free” spins. Nobody gives away money; the casino simply hopes you’ll chase the inevitable loss.

Take the likes of Bet365, William Hill, or LeoVegas – they all parade “free” offers with the same smug grin. Their fine print reads like a novel, but the key line is always the same: you must wager a multiple of the bonus before you can cash out. The “instant” part only speeds the grind, not the eventual disappointment.

  • Sign‑up bonus – usually a deposit match that disappears if you don’t meet turnover.
  • Free spins – limited to specific slots, capped payouts, and strict time windows.
  • Loyalty points – a never‑ending loop that pretends to reward you while keeping you in the system.

And then there’s the psychological trap. The moment those 50 spins land on a reel, your brain lights up like a Christmas tree. You’re not thinking about variance; you’re feeling the rush of a potential win. That rush is what the casino wants, not the win itself.

Practical Example: The Real‑World Cost

Suppose you’re a player who has never deposited a penny. You register, claim the 50 spins, and watch the reels dance. You land a modest win of £0.20 on Starburst, then another £0.15 on Gonzo’s Quest. After a few more spins, you hit the maximum payout limit – perhaps £5 total. The casino now asks you to wager a 20× multiple, meaning you need to bet £100 before you can withdraw that £5.

In reality, you’ve spent hours chasing a £5 buffer that will never become a viable bankroll. The “instant” label merely speeds up the process of feeding you into the wagering treadmill. You’re left with the bitter taste of a free lollipop at the dentist – sweet for a moment, then a sharp reminder that sugar doesn’t pay the bills.

Think about it: the effort required to meet the wagering condition far outweighs the initial excitement. You’re essentially gambling on top of gambling. The casino’s maths are sound – they profit from the average player who never reaches the withdrawal threshold.

What the Savvy Player Should Keep in Mind

First, treat every “free” promotion as a cost centre, not a profit centre. The instant nature merely accelerates the inevitable loss. Second, scrutinise the wagering requirements – they’re the hidden tax that turns “free” into “expensive”. Third, compare the bonus structures across brands. Bet365 may offer a larger deposit match, but LeoVegas could have a more forgiving spin cap. None of them are charitable; they’re all trying to lock you in.

And finally, remember that the only thing that never changes is the house edge. No amount of glittering graphics, no matter how many free spins are on offer, will tilt the odds in your favour.
